Your adventure kicks off at the water sports center located right on the beach of Hotel Epidaurus. This is a prime location—easy to find and close to other attractions in Cavtat. The team here includes friendly, knowledgeable staff ready to brief you on safety and equipment. As you get geared up, you’ll notice the equipment is modern and well-maintained, adding a layer of reassurance.
Once everyone is ready, a comfortable speedboat takes you out to the ideal parasailing spot. This part of the experience is as much a scenic cruise as it is part of the adventure. Expect to pass by the coastline’s rugged shoreline, with glimpses of rocky coves, lush greenery, and glimpses of the open sea. For many, this boat ride is a highlight, giving a chance to relax and take in the scenery before the flight.
When it’s your turn, the crew helps you into the harness, and you’re securely attached to the parachute. As the boat accelerates, you’ll feel the lift-off—an exhilarating moment of weightlessness. The guides are professional and attentive, ensuring you’re comfortable and safe throughout. The views from above are genuinely spectacular—crystal waters, boat traffic, and the shimmering coastline stretch out in every direction.
A reviewer described it as a “fantastic experience” with “stunning views,” emphasizing how memorable the scenery is from this new vantage point. Another noted the “amazing service,” highlighting how guides like Ivan and Luka go out of their way to make sure everyone has a smooth ride.
While airborne, you’ll see the coastline from a perspective few get to experience. The clear waters below often reveal marine life—schools of fish, perhaps even a curious dolphin or two. This adds an extra dimension to your flight, transforming it from a simple thrill ride into a fascinating visual experience.
After your flight, the boat gently brings you back to the starting point. The entire activity, from the boat ride to flying and returning, typically takes around 20-30 minutes—enough to satisfy your craving for adrenaline without feeling rushed.

How much does the parasailing experience cost?
It costs $118 per group, which can accommodate up to one person. The price covers the equipment, crew, and instructor.
Where does the activity start and end?
It begins at the water sports center located on the beach of Hotel Epidaurus and ends back at the same meeting point.
What is included in the tour?
Your price includes the equipment, the crew, and a professional instructor to oversee the activity.
How long does the activity last?
The entire experience, including boat ride and parasailing, typically lasts around 20-30 minutes.
Is there a minimum or maximum weight for participation?
Yes, the minimum weight is 60kg and the maximum is 200kg, so most adults can participate.
Is this activity suitable for families?
Yes, it’s suitable for families, especially those with older children, as well as couples and groups.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, providing flexibility if your schedule shifts.
